Engineering Metal Oxide Nanostructures for the Fiber Optic Sensor Platform
This article presents an effective integration scheme of nanostructured SnO₂ with the fiber optic platform for chemical sensing applications based on evanescent optical interactions.

A resonant single frequency molecular detector with high sensitivity and selectivity for gas mixtures
Article theoretically demonstrates a single low frequency gas detector that can be used for sensing of gas mixtures with high selectivity, accuracy, and sensitivity.
